1996 Chevrolet Cavalier vs. 2011 Opel Combo
To start off, 2011 Opel Combo is newer by 15 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1996 Chevrolet Cavalier.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1996 Chevrolet Cavalier would be higher. At 2,190 cc (4 cylinders), 1996 Chevrolet Cavalier is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1996 Chevrolet Cavalier (120 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 31 more horse power than 2011 Opel Combo. (89 HP @ 5600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1996 Chevrolet Cavalier should accelerate faster than 2011 Opel Combo.
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1996 Chevrolet Cavalier (183 Nm @ 3600 RPM) has 57 more torque (in Nm) than 2011 Opel Combo. (126 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 1996 Chevrolet Cavalier will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2011 Opel Combo.
Compare all specifications:
1996 Chevrolet Cavalier | 2011 Opel Combo | |
Make | Chevrolet | Opel |
Model | Cavalier | Combo |
Year Released | 1996 | 2011 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2190 cc | 1364 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 4 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 120 HP | 89 HP |
Engine RPM | 5200 RPM | 5600 RPM |
Torque | 183 Nm | 126 Nm |
Torque RPM | 3600 RPM | 4000 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Front | Front |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 2 seats |
Number of Doors | 4 doors | 3 doors |
Vehicle Length | 4600 mm | 4330 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1750 mm | 1810 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1380 mm | 1690 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2650 mm | 2720 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 57 L | 52 L |
